So, US-52 has been rerouted onto the King Coal Highway?

hbelkins

Quote from: rickmastfan67 on January 07, 2013, 11:33:58 PM
Quote from: hbelkins on January 05, 2013, 08:06:04 PM
Some new Flickr entries...

http://www.flickr.com/photos/hbelkins/sets/72157632429246347/

These are various photos from around Kentucky the last six months of 2012, plus some of the new US 52 segment in Mingo County, WV, with new signage for the WV 44 extension.

So, US-52 has been rerouted onto the King Coal Highway?

Last time I was up there, which was back in the fall as depicted in those photos, the new section between WV 65 and the WV 44 extension was signed as US 52. However, there was no signage at the US 52/WV 65 intersection routing US 52 onto WV 65 up the mountain to the new road.

That may have changed since those pictures were taken, but unfortunately I don't know when I will be back up that way to verify.
